
Artificial Intelligence and Software Engineering: The Rise and Fall of Devin
Today's technology, offers revolutionary developments in the field of artificial intelligence. One of these developments is, Cognition AI Devin is an artificial intelligence software engineer named Devin, developed by Devin. Devin is an automation tool that promises to help software engineers. However, recent tests show that Devin is much less successful than expected.
Devin's Introduction and Promises
Devin, which will be introduced in early 2024, will provide software engineers with automatic tasks This tool, which was offered for a monthly subscription fee of $500, aimed to enable users to manage complex processes such as application development and troubleshooting more efficiently. Devin, Slack It works by taking commands from and Docker It supported software projects by providing integration with various tools in a software-based environment.
Devin's Functionality and Expectations
Devin stood out with its ability to perform important tasks such as API integration, code reviews, and infrastructure management. It also developed a Doordash There was even the ability to order food via . However, the reality of these promises began to be questioned with the tests conducted.
Tests and Results: Disappointment
A respected AI research lab Answer.AI, conducted extensive testing to evaluate Devin's performance. In these tests, Devin was able to successfully complete only 20 out of a total of 3 tasks. Among the tasks he completed were Notion from database Google Sheets, and developing a simple planetary tracking application. However, on complex tasks Devin encountered technical problems and often came up with faulty solutions.
Problems and Obstacles Encountered
During testing, it was observed that Devin failed to recognize some basic obstacles and produce workable solutions. For example, Devin was given multiple applications Railway When asked to deploy it on his platform, he failed to understand that the platform did not support such a feature. This caused Devin to come up with imaginary solutions and waste days of time. Although the researchers admitted that Devin's interface was user-friendly, they noted that the tool had serious shortcomings in terms of reliability.
Devin's Future and Development Potential
Devin, a composite artificial intelligence system It is defined as and is based on basic AI models. In theory, it is expected to do everything that other AI systems can do. However, current performance levels suggest that Devin needs further development to fulfill its potential. While the researchers acknowledge that Devin has shown promising results in some tasks, they emphasize that its overall success is insufficient.
Artificial Intelligence and Software Development Processes
While AI has the potential to transform software development processes, Devin’s performance shows that this potential has yet to be fully realized. Because software engineering is a field that requires complex thinking and problem-solving skills, it is still unclear to what extent AI systems can integrate into these processes. Systems like Devin need to be fed more data and constantly updated to meet user expectations.
Conclusion: The Future of Devin and Artificial Intelligence
Devin shows how complex and challenging AI work can be. Developer teams need to take user feedback into account to improve the performance of the system and achieve better results. Taking the right steps in the field of AI and software engineering can lead to more efficient and effective tools in the future. Therefore, developing and testing tools like Devin is of vital importance to the software engineering world.